Latvia Emerges as Northern Europe’s Web3 and Crypto Leader
Latvia is establishing itself as a key hub for Web3 and cryptocurrency in Northern Europe by leveraging its MiCA licensing framework and a favorable regulatory environment. This has led to an influx of Web3 firms seeking to take advantage of the country's supportive tech ecosystem.
The combination of public-private partnerships and crypto-friendly regulations positions Latvia as a competitive alternative for companies looking to operate within the EU's evolving digital finance landscape. As more firms relocate or expand into Latvia, this might reshape the regional ecosystem for cryptocurrency and blockchain innovation.
